位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

excel为什么不能计数器

作者:excel百科网
|
354人看过
发布时间:2026-01-21 02:15:51
标签:
Excel 为什么不能计数器:揭秘其设计局限与替代方案在现代办公软件中,Excel 是一个不可或缺的工具。它以其强大的数据处理能力和直观的界面深受用户喜爱。然而,许多人对 Excel 的功能存在误解,尤其是关于“计数器”这一功能。本文
excel为什么不能计数器
Excel 为什么不能计数器:揭秘其设计局限与替代方案
在现代办公软件中,Excel 是一个不可或缺的工具。它以其强大的数据处理能力和直观的界面深受用户喜爱。然而,许多人对 Excel 的功能存在误解,尤其是关于“计数器”这一功能。本文将深入探讨 Excel 为何不能直接实现计数器功能,并分析其设计逻辑、局限性,以及替代方案。
一、Excel 的计数器功能简介
Excel 作为一种电子表格软件,其核心功能之一是数据处理与分析。在实际应用中,用户常常需要对数据进行计数,例如统计某一列中满足特定条件的单元格数量。Excel 提供了多种计数函数,如 COUNT、COUNTA、COUNTIF、COUNTIFS 等,这些函数能够满足不同的计数需求。
然而,这些函数本质上是基于数据的逻辑判断,而不是计数器的物理计数。例如,COUNT 函数会统计某一范围内数值的个数,而 COUNTIF 则会统计满足特定条件的单元格数量。这些函数本质上是计算逻辑,而不是计数器的物理计数。
二、Excel 无法实现计数器功能的原理
Excel 的设计初衷是处理复杂的计算与数据分析,而非简单的计数器功能。其核心逻辑基于数据的结构与逻辑判断,而非物理计数。因此,Excel 无法直接实现计数器功能,原因如下:
1. 数据结构限制
Excel 的数据结构是基于行和列的,每个单元格存储的是数值或文本。要实现计数器功能,需要将数据存储为计数器变量,这在 Excel 的数据结构中并不适用。计数器变量通常需要独立的单元格或公式来维护其值,而 Excel 的数据结构并不支持这种变量管理。
2. 公式逻辑限制
Excel 的公式逻辑基于数据的计算,而不是计数器的物理计数。例如,COUNT 函数会统计数值个数,而 COUNTIF 则会统计满足条件的单元格数量。这些函数本质上是计算逻辑,而不是计数器的物理计数。因此,Excel 无法直接实现计数器功能。
3. 交互性与动态性限制
Excel 的交互性与动态性主要体现在其公式与数据的联动上。计数器功能通常需要动态更新,例如在某个单元格中增加或减少计数。然而,Excel 的数据结构并不支持这种动态更新,因此无法实现计数器功能。
三、Excel 为何不能实现计数器功能的深层原因
Excel 的设计逻辑基于数据的处理与分析,而非计数器的物理计数。其核心功能是基于数据的结构与逻辑判断,而不是计数器的物理计数。因此,Excel 无法直接实现计数器功能,原因如下:
1. 数据结构与逻辑判断的限制
Excel 的数据结构是基于行和列的,每个单元格存储的是数值或文本。要实现计数器功能,需要将数据存储为计数器变量,这在 Excel 的数据结构中并不适用。计数器变量通常需要独立的单元格或公式来维护其值,而 Excel 的数据结构并不支持这种变量管理。
2. 公式逻辑与计算方式的限制
Excel 的公式逻辑基于数据的计算,而不是计数器的物理计数。例如,COUNT 函数会统计数值个数,而 COUNTIF 则会统计满足条件的单元格数量。这些函数本质上是计算逻辑,而不是计数器的物理计数。因此,Excel 无法直接实现计数器功能。
3. 交互性与动态性限制
Excel 的交互性与动态性主要体现在其公式与数据的联动上。计数器功能通常需要动态更新,例如在某个单元格中增加或减少计数。然而,Excel 的数据结构并不支持这种动态更新,因此无法实现计数器功能。
四、Excel 无法实现计数器功能的现实影响
Excel 无法实现计数器功能,对用户而言意味着在处理数据时需要采用其他方式。例如,用户需要手动维护计数器变量,或者使用其他工具来实现计数器功能。
1. 手动维护计数器变量
在 Excel 中,用户可以通过手动输入数值来维护计数器变量。例如,用户可以创建一个单独的单元格来存储计数器值,并在需要时更新该单元格的值。这种方法虽然简单,但不够灵活,且容易出错。
2. 使用其他工具实现计数器功能
除了 Excel 本身,用户还可以使用其他工具来实现计数器功能,如 Python、VBA、Power Query 等。这些工具提供了更灵活的数据处理能力,能够满足复杂的计数需求。
五、Excel 无法实现计数器功能的替代方案
尽管 Excel 无法直接实现计数器功能,但用户仍然可以通过其他方式实现计数器功能。以下是几种常见的替代方案:
1. 使用 COUNT 和 COUNTIF 函数
COUNT 函数可以统计某一范围内数值的个数,而 COUNTIF 则可以统计满足特定条件的单元格数量。这些函数虽然不是计数器,但可以满足大多数计数需求。
2. 使用 VBA 实现计数器功能
VBA(Visual Basic for Applications)是一种编程语言,可以用于自动化 Excel 的操作。用户可以通过编写 VBA 代码来实现计数器功能,例如创建一个计数器变量,并在需要时更新其值。
3. 使用 Power Query 实现计数器功能
Power Query 是 Excel 的一个数据处理工具,可以用于数据清洗和转换。用户可以通过 Power Query 实现计数器功能,例如创建一个计数器变量,并在需要时更新其值。
4. 使用 Python 实现计数器功能
Python 是一种高级编程语言,可以用于数据处理和分析。用户可以通过 Python 实现计数器功能,例如创建一个计数器变量,并在需要时更新其值。
六、总结与建议
Excel 无法直接实现计数器功能,这是因为其设计逻辑基于数据的处理与分析,而非计数器的物理计数。用户在使用 Excel 时,可以通过其他方式实现计数器功能,如使用 COUNT 和 COUNTIF 函数、VBA 编程、Power Query 或 Python 等。在实际应用中,用户应根据具体需求选择合适的工具,以实现高效的计数功能。
总之,尽管 Excel 无法直接实现计数器功能,但通过其他方式,用户仍然可以实现计数需求。在实际工作中,用户应充分了解 Excel 的功能限制,并灵活运用其他工具,以提高工作效率。
推荐文章
相关文章
推荐URL
Excel为何每次都要设置时间?深度解析与实用技巧Excel作为一种广泛应用于数据处理与分析的办公软件,其核心功能之一是时间的管理与计算。在Excel中,时间的设置不仅影响着数据的展示形式,还深刻影响着数据的运算逻辑。本文将从时间设置
2026-01-21 02:15:21
85人看过
Excel中“组合”是什么意思?深度解析组合在Excel中的应用与意义Excel是一款功能强大的电子表格工具,广泛应用于数据处理、财务分析、统计计算、报表制作等多个领域。在Excel中,用户经常会遇到“组合”这个术语,但很多人对其含义
2026-01-21 02:15:08
158人看过
Excel公式加$是什么意思:深度解析与实战应用在Excel中,公式是实现数据处理和计算的核心工具。而其中最常被用户关注的,莫过于“加$”这个符号。它在Excel公式中起到关键作用,能够控制单元格的引用范围,使公式在不同单元格中保持一
2026-01-21 02:15:02
221人看过
电脑为什么自动弹出Excel?深度解析在日常使用电脑的过程中,我们可能会遇到一个常见的现象:电脑在运行过程中,自动弹出Excel文件。这个现象看似简单,但背后却涉及操作系统、软件设置、文件管理等多个层面的复杂机制。本文将从多个角度深入
2026-01-21 02:14:56
205人看过
热门推荐
热门专题:
资讯中心: